Create the Perfect Resume
This program will be held at the Mullica Hill Branch
Tuesdays, March 23 and March 30, 10am-12noon "The Perfect Resume", a two-part workshop, will be led by business trainer and consultant Robert Marino. In Part I, learn the elements of a good resume and how to put them together. In Part II, bring your revised resume for review and suggestions. This workshop is free. Advance registration is required.

Free Business Advice from the SBA
This program will be held at the Mullica Hill Branch

Tuesday, March 23rd at 6:30pm      A representative from the US Small Business Administration will explain the technical assistance and financing options available to those interested in starting a business or expanding their existing business. Come with your business ideas and questions. Advance registration is advised.

This program will be repeated at the Logan Branch on April 21st.
